The last ATP 1000 masters is underway at Cincinnati and day 2 featured the Swiss Roger Federer in action. Top seeds like David Ferrer and Kei Nishikori has withdrawn from the tournament which makes the tourney a little bit competitive. Day two also featured top seeds like Tomas Berdych, Marin Cilic in action.

Roger Federer after missing out the Rogers cup was up and ready for the action at Cincinnati. The Swiss who is chasing for his seventh Cincinnati title was off to a good start defeating the Spaniard Roberto Bautista Agut in straight sets 6-4, 6-4

However, Federer didn’t play a completely dominating match but was good enough to book a spot in the third round. Federer’s first serve percentage was poor maintaining just 43 %. But the Swiss managed to win most of the first serve points. Federer broke the Spaniard twice in ten attempts which was good enough for the Swiss to seal a comfortable victory.

 

 

Other results of Men’s singles 2nd round at Cincinnati:

I Karlovic def. M Klizan 6-3, 7-6(2)

A Dolgopolov def. B Tomic 6-4, 6-1

T Berdych def. T Bellucci 6-2, 6-3

M Cilic def. J Sousa 6-4, 6-2

G Dimitrov def. V Pospisil 7-6(4), 7-6(5)
